Court Recognizes Retaliation For Filing HIPAA Privacy Complaint As Basis For Texas Whistleblower Claim

In a March 19, 2009 ruling, the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Texas recently recognized that the Texas Whistleblower Act prohibits health care organizations run by the State of Texas from retaliating against employees for making good faith complaints of violations of the Privacy Rules of the Health Insurance Portability Act (“HIPAA”),  Nevertheless, the court dismissed the wrongful discharge lawsuit brought by a former Terrell State Hospital security guard who alleged he was wrongfully fired for complaining to the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services Office of Civil Rights (OCR) that the Hospital violated the HIPAA Privacy Rules because the plaintiff had failed to present sufficient proof that he was terminated in retaliation for filing a HIPAA complaint.
